Setting up virtual host on local machine running MAMP 1.7.2

virtual-host

When your working on a development site, it's always best to mirror your production site. In most cases production site is always going to be installed in the webroot (root directory on your web hosting server). But how do we mirror this setup for MAMP running on a local machine if your development sites all lives under one directory where the sites are being served up by Apache web server? Development has ceased for 1pixelout player for Joomla & a final note about volume control

I'm still receiving many emails about 1pixelout player for Joomla and i think it's time to set the record straight on the development progress. Before that, i do want to thank everyone for downloading and using it on their sites.

Since i have decided to switch to using Drupal a year ago, i have ceased development of all my Joomla extensions / plugins due to not having enough time. Importing large DB file into mySQL

Phpmyadmin is a great DB tool but can really suck on trying to import large DB files. Another much better option is to use bigdump.
